Understanding On-Grid Solar Panel Systems
On-grid photovoltaic system systems offer a popular method for producing electricity by sunlight. These units are engineered to interface directly to the utility network, allowing you to supply excess power back to the provider and possibly earn credits on your account. Unlike off-grid solutions, on-grid setups need a connection to the main power line. Here’s a quick summary:
- Grid Interconnection: Automatically connects to the electrical network.
- Net Metering: Permits supplying excess power back to the grid.
- No Batteries: Typically doesn't contain storage backup.
- Reliability: Depends the stability of the power grid.

Advantages of a Utility-Connected Solar System for Your Dwelling
A utility-connected solar installation offers significant benefits for homeowners . Primarily, you are able to continue to use electricity from the electric company when your solar arrays aren't creating enough energy, ensuring a consistent energy supply . Furthermore, any extra energy your system generates and doesn't utilize can be fed back to the network , often leading to rebates on your monthly electric bill . This may dramatically reduce your cumulative energy expenses , making solar a budgetarily wise investment .
